1st Sept

This one will make you laugh, wasn't going to tell you guys but guess who FAILED her written driving test this morning? moi - oh the shame and they won't let you go back and do it until the next day. I failed by one mark, which I disputed. The rule book said you have to turn right and go into the right hand lane, but the test answer was that you can change lanes. When I disputed this they said tough the rule changed 2 years ago and we just forgot to update it in the book!! and guess what? you can also put your life in danger by riding in the back of a yute as long as it has role bars - until 2005, they are really going to stop you suffering major head trauma - which is what I have today. I'm so cross at myself as I had most of the answers right and went back and changed a few before I finished and guess what? I'd changed all the right ones to wrong ones - I do worry sometimes.

Bit of good news - Centrelink did back date my payments from the day I arrived (that's for Warren) but I'm not touching it incase we have to pay any back - bit pointles having it really if I can't bloody spend it

We are now the proud owners of a decent sized block of Australian sand! (refunable deposit if house sale goes tits up - but our offer has ben accepted) 20 mins from Hillary's and 20 mins from Perth, just of Alexander Drive in Landsdale. May not suit everyones tastes, but we like it.

It's opposite the park, a 2 min walk to school, 5 mins from Reid Highway so we are very pleased. Don't forget darling it was me who found it and will take full credit!!.

Been for a planning meeting with house builders and we are all set to go when the house in the uk exchanges.

We just have one minor thing to sort and that's Warren getting a job, but there's always burger flippin'.

Went out with one of the rels yesterday and had a drive around further north - Jondalup. Now my impressions of it where it was like a little town all of it's own, very clean, nicely laid out, some lovely houses but little or no land in the bits that I saw. Driving around the backs of some of them, with garages at the back reminded me of holiday villas in Spain. Now this was just my impression and lots of you will like it, I can see the appeal, but just not for me. Landsdale may not be your thing as I think it's a bit like Stepford, but that's why I like it

Anyway from what I gather so far there is a vast difference in 'the feel' of each suburb and you do have to visit them. It very obviously depends what you are after.

Btw, girls, yesterday I went to Harbour Town, that outlet shopping centre!
It was much bigger than I expected(LOTS of shops, including Pumkin patch for kids, and Cotton World(seeing as everybody seems to miss cotton).
I got converse sneakers(just low ones) for $40 (usually 130), and a dress for $20. And then in was 5.30 and all the shops closed It was great, we have to go there sometime!
Oh, and then I decided to take that little bit of Freeway home(Wellington - Powis st), and it was a traffic jam!! So that's that myth dispelled

Another thing discoverd: it costs about $35 to send a 1.6kg package home(ehhhhh, Europe)! And that's economy air (2-3 weeks).
Normal air(10 days aprox) is about $45 or so, and sea(3 months or so) is $20 or so.........
